Macnica Linux ST 2110 support enables 32 uncompressed HD flows

Macnica Linux ST 2110 support enables 32 uncompressed HD flows
Radio & Television Business Report

Macnica is expanding Linux support for its MEP100 SmartNIC and M2S Media Streaming SDK to facilitate SMPTE ST 2110 development. The platform enables 32 uncompressed HD flows over 100GbE by offloading transport tasks from host CPUs to hardware, with demonstrations scheduled for IBC 2026.

Key Takeaways

  • MEP100 SmartNIC executes ST 2110-21 pacing and ST 2022-7 hitless protection in hardware to preserve CPU resources
  • Zero-copy DMA and NVIDIA GPUDirect integration deliver media frames directly to GPU memory for low-latency processing
  • Validated hardware platforms developed with Advantech aim to reduce integration effort for broadcast manufacturers
  • Demonstrations at IBC 2026 will feature interoperable environments using technologies from wTVision and Softron

Why It Matters

Expanding Linux support for the MEP100 SmartNIC addresses the industry's shift toward software-defined production where GPU-heavy workloads are standard. By offloading the complex SMPTE ST 2110 stack to dedicated hardware, developers can allocate server resources to high-value applications like AI-driven analytics and real-time rendering rather than basic media transport. This move strengthens the open-standards ecosystem by providing a high-density, low-cost-per-channel path for manufacturers moving away from proprietary hardware. Watch for the performance benchmarks of these 32-channel flows during the live demonstrations at IBC 2026 to see how the hardware handles peak throughput without host degradation.

Additional Context

Macnica's MEP100 SmartNIC enters a competitive field of ST 2110 hardware acceleration options that are reshaping how broadcasters approach software-defined production. NVIDIA has long dominated this space with its ConnectX and BlueField SmartNIC lines, which support SMPTE ST 2110 media transport and are widely deployed in broadcast facilities for IP-based video workflows. NVIDIA's Mellanox-branded adapters have become the de facto reference hardware for many ST 2110 implementations, and the company's partnership ecosystem spans major broadcast equipment vendors. Macnica's entry with a 32-channel, Linux-native offering targets the cost-sensitive end of this market where operators want high-density uncompressed flows without the premium pricing associated with GPU-accelerated platforms. The broader ST 2110 ecosystem continues to mature as well. SMPTE's standard for professional media over IP has gained significant traction since its initial publication, with major broadcasters and production facilities migrating from SDI to IP-based infrastructure. The standard's modular approach, separating video, audio, and ancillary data into distinct streams, has driven demand for flexible hardware that can handle multiple simultaneous flows. Companies like Advantech have also entered this space with server platforms optimized for media processing workloads, providing the compute foundation on which SmartNICs like the MEP100 operate. wTVision and Softron, both mentioned in connection with Macnica's ecosystem, represent the software layer that increasingly relies on hardware offload to manage complex production workflows. The technical case for hardware offload in ST 2110 environments is well established. Each uncompressed HD video stream at 1080p60 requires approximately 3 Gbps of bandwidth, meaning 32 simultaneous flows consume roughly 96 Gbps in each direction. Without dedicated hardware handling the transport protocol stack, including precise timing synchronization via PTP (IEEE 1588), host CPUs would be overwhelmed managing packet scheduling, buffering, and flow control. Macnica's approach of offloading these tasks to the SmartNIC's dedicated hardware mirrors the architecture that has proven effective in data center networking, where SmartNICs handle encryption, compression, and protocol processing to free up general-purpose compute for application workloads. The zero-copy media pipeline capability is particularly relevant for latency-sensitive broadcast applications where every microsecond of processing delay matters in live production environments.
